Replacing interior lighting bulbs (VW Golf 1)

On the left in the picture it is shown how the degree of movement indication is illuminated in the automatic transmission: 1 - bracket of the dump; 2 - cartridge; 3 - lamp with glass base.

On the right - lighting for the ashtray and lighter, as well as the heating system lever: 4 - clamping sleeve for the lighter; 5 - lamp socket for lighting the ashtray and lighter; 6 - lamp socket for lighting the heating lever.


Lighting for the control unit of the heating and ventilation system



The device for illuminating the heating and ventilation symbols is located on the right in the flap of the heating system lever. The lamp lights up when the parking and main lights are switched on.

Remove the lever flap (see chapter "Heating and ventilation").

Turn the bulb holder on the back of the shutter slightly to the left and remove it.

Remove the bulb from the socket. This is a glass-base bulb (1.2 W DIN Form W).

Ashtray and lighter lighting



A 1.2W DIN glass base bulb, shape VV, together with the socket, is inserted between the ashtray and the lighter. The bulb lights up when the car lights up.



On Golf models produced before July 1980: remove the glove box. See chapter "Car interior".

On Golf models built after August 1980 and Jetta: Remove the instrument panel cover at the bottom right as described in Chapter "Car interior".

On all models: Remove the bulb holder located between the ashtray and the lighter towards the engine compartment.

Remove the light bulb from the socket.

Indication of the stage of movement



Disengage the damper at the bottom, near the control lever; turn 90 degrees and remove.

At the bottom, near the control lever, pull the lamp socket out of the holder.

Remove the light bulb with a glass base from the socket (1.2W DIN W-type).

Glove compartment light bulb



Open the glove compartment.

Remove the lamp housing from the top right.

Remove the spotlight bulb (3W, length 28mm) from both locking tabs.

Trunk light



Open the trunk lid.

Pull out the bulb housing.

Remove the spotlight (3W, length 28mm) from her clamps.
